COUNCIL OF EDUCATION.

(rBEBS ABBOCIATION IZLEGEASI.)

WELLINGTON, March 4

■Regulations appear in to-night's "Gazette" for the conduct of the oloction of members of the Council of Education, the setting up of which tvas provided for in last year's amendment to the Education Act. There aro eight classes of electors for whom rolls aro to be provided, as follows:—North Island Education Boards' roll, South Island Education Boards' roll, North Island public school male teachers' roll, South Island public school male teachers' roll, the secondary and technical male teachers' roll, tho North Island Eublic school women teachers' roll, the outli Island public school women teachers* roll, the secondary and technical women teachers' roll. Too election is fixed annually for the elective members of the (Jouncil for the socoad Monday in each May.
